The self-made hypereutectic Al-30Si alloy is studied in this paper. By means of low superheat pouring low intensity electromagnetism stirring which is a new type of semi-solid slurry preparation
the semi-solid Al-30Si alloy slurry is prepared and the effect of treating parameters on the hardness
wearing performance and thermal stability of samples is studied. The research process is important for this new semi-solid technology to widen the application field and the results can be provided for the deep development of Al-30Si materials.
